Man nabbed for online betting scam involving over Rs 240 million



KATHMANDU: The police have made public a person involved in transacting over Rs 240 million through online betting.

A team from the Kathmandu Valley Crime Investigation Office arrested Pintu Kumar Sah, 30, of Damak Municipality-12, from Jhapa and made him public on Friday after bringing him to Kathmandu, said Superintendent of Police, Rabindra Regmi.

Regmi added that Sah was arrested from Jhapa based on the complaint that he made transactions of Rs 241.5 million through online betting and games misusing the internet against the rules of the National Rastra Bank.

Sah has been sent to the District Police Range, Teku for further investigation into the case.
